If the gossips are to be believed and Chelsea Clinton is indeed engaged to Goldman Sachs banker Marc Mezvinsky, then we can expect a sighting around the Shake Shack in the near future. A source says Mezvinsky, who according to some reports has been friends with the former First Daughter since the two were teens, has bought a 2,000-square-foot, three-bedroom condo in the Flatiron district that’s priced at about $3.8 million. Mezvinsky, the son of former Iowa congressman (and current incarcerated felon) Edward Mezvinsky, apparently toured the place with Clinton, suggesting that he sought her approval before signing off on the purchase. Assuming the deal goes through, it would end what appears to have been a protracted search on Mezvinsky’s part; a source claims the two toured various downtown properties last fall. As for Chelsea herself, at present she lives a few blocks away, somewhere in the vicinity of Gramercy Park.
